First iOS 8 jailbreak now available for iPhone and iPad

Image
A jailbreak tool has been released for iOS 8 just over a month after Apple’s latest OS was first officially launched. The new software comes courtesy of Chinese tinkerers Team Pangu, and is the first jailbreak for the iOS 8 . The jailbreak gives anyone with the latest iOS software root admin access to their smartphone, circumcenting Apple’s standard user restrictions. Pangu says its jailbreak will work fine on both iOS 8 and the newly released iOS 8.1 update. The jailbreaker team also recommends backing up your device before you take the root access leap, just in case something goes wrong and causes data loss. Many users are complaining that the jailbreak has come too early, since Cydia software and English language are not currently available. Pangu may have rushed out the jailbreak tool to be remembered as the first hackers to crack the software. How To Jailbreak iOS 6 1 2 Untethered With Evasi0n 1 4

Apple released iOS 6.1.2 last week to fix some lingering issues experienced by iPhone 4S and to a lesser degree other iPhone users. Although battery drain issue due to excessive Microsoft exchange communication between the Microsoft server and iDevice was fixed, passcode issue is still there. Consequently, this new update release is just for bug fixes and doesnt really bring any new features to the device. This means that if you dont have battery drain problem and dont care about the Microsoft exchange stuff or dont use it, then you may not go through the hassle of updating. However, if you want to update to iOS 6.1.2 and jailbreak untethered, below is a step by step process which is an excerpt of the more detailed process here.
